Nurturing a Healthy Future: Promoting a Balanced Diet for Hispanic Kids

Introduction: In today's fast-paced world, ensuring children maintain a balanced diet can be a challenge for any parent. However, for Hispanic households, it becomes even more crucial to incorporate cultural traditions while striving to offer a healthy and well-rounded diet for their kids. In this article, we will explore ways to nourish and support the Hispanic community's children through a balanced diet that honors their heritage and promotes optimal health. 1. Embrace Traditional Foods with a Nutritional Twist: Hispanic cuisine is rich in flavor and variety, with staples like rice, beans, and corn featuring prominently. To create a balanced diet, it's essential to retain these traditional foods while making modifications to enhance their nutritional value. For example, replacing white rice with brown rice increases fiber content, or opting for whole grain tortillas instead of refined flour tortillas adds essential nutrients. By making these small adjustments, we can preserve the cultural significance of these dishes while ensuring optimal nutrition. 2. Introduce Colorful Fruits and Vegetables: Incorporating vibrant fruits and vegetables into meals not only adds visual appeal but also provides essential vitamins and minerals. Hispanic cuisine offers a wide range of produce options, including avocado, tomatoes, peppers, and tropical fruits such as mango and papaya. By encouraging children to include these colorful foods in their daily diet, parents can help them develop a taste for nutrient-rich options and reap the benefits of a well-balanced diet. 3. Empower Children to Make Healthy Choices: Teaching children about nutrition and involving them in meal planning can foster a sense of ownership over their eating habits. Encourage them to participate in grocery shopping, meal preparation, and even gardening, if possible. Allowing kids to choose their favorite fruits or vegetables and helping them understand the importance of including a variety of food groups in each meal can go a long way in promoting a balanced and nutritious diet. 4. Limit Sugary Drinks and Processed Snacks: In many Hispanic households, sugary drinks and processed snacks can be prevalent. However, these items often lack essential nutrients and contribute to a higher risk of childhood obesity and other health issues. Encourage water or milk as the main beverage choices and limit the consumption of sugary drinks and processed snacks. Offering healthier alternatives such as homemade fruit-infused water or nutritious homemade snacks can help combat the intake of empty calories. 5. Foster a Culture of Family Meals: In Hispanic culture, meals are often seen as a time for connection and shared experiences. Encouraging regular family meals can create a positive environment for children to learn about healthy eating habits. By setting the table together, involving kids in meal preparation, and fostering open conversations during mealtimes, we can reinforce the importance of nutrition while strengthening family bonds. Conclusion: Nurturing a healthy future begins with providing Hispanic children with a balanced diet that embraces their cultural heritage. By incorporating traditional foods with a nutritional twist, introducing colorful fruits and vegetables, empowering children to make healthy choices, limiting sugary drinks and processed snacks, and fostering a culture of family meals, we can create a foundation for lifelong health and well-being. Let us come together as a community and prioritize our children's health, ensuring they grow up to be strong, vibrant individuals rooted in their heritage.
